1. How often should I water?Different seasons and different maintenance environments will affect the number of times succulents need to be watered. In general, spring and autumn are its growing seasons. When the surface soil in the pot is about 70% to 80% dry, you can water it. About once a week is enough. In summer and winter, it will enter a dormant period, and you should reduce watering at this time. In winter, you only need to water it once every 15 to 20 days. In summer, the temperature is high and the water will evaporate quickly, so you only need to water it once a week, but don't water it too much. 2. PrecautionsIt is best to water in the evening, as the water will evaporate better overnight. When watering, gently pour the water along the wall of the pot. If water droplets splash onto the leaves, blow them away. |
